Russia’s Elena Sidneva Rides Fuhur to Personal Best Score to Win Lipica World Cup Freestyle

5 years ago StraightArrow Comments Off on Russia’s Elena Sidneva Rides Fuhur to Personal Best Score to Win Lipica World Cup Freestyle

LIPICA, Slovenia, May 26, 2019–Russia’s Elena Sidneva rode Fuhur to a personal best score to win the World Cup Grand Prix Freestyle Sunday.

The win on the 10-year-old Russian-bred gelding on a score of 74.655% came a day after taking the Grand Prix that was the first victory for the pair since starting Big Tour in March 2018.

Elena competed for Russia at the 2000 Sydney Olympics as well as three World Games and five World Cup Finals and is seeking to earn one of two starting places in the Central European League for the final in Las Vegas next April.

Germany’s Uwe Schwanz and Hermes, 11-year-old German Sport Horse gelding, were second on 73.950% with Austria’s Amanda Hartung on Dresscode Black third on 73.075%.
